Step 2: Read the Wagering Requirements (Yes, Really)

I don’t skim them. I look for specific numbers. For example, a decent bonus might have “35x wagering on the bonus amount” with a “Max cashout of £150”. That means you can only win £150 from the free spins. If it says “50x wagering within 72 hours”, I usually skip it. That is too tight for me. I prefer offers with a 7-day expiry.

Step 3: Pick the Right Games

Not all slots count the same. A game like Starburst might only contribute 50% to the wagering, while a lower volatility slot like Book of Dead might count 100%. Check the T&Cs for the “game contribution” section. I always play on games that contribute 100% to meet the playthrough.

What You Need to Know Before You Claim (T&Cs that Matter)

I get it. Reading terms and conditions is boring. But I found a few nasty surprises in the small print of the latest no deposit casino bonuses UK 2026 claim now offers. Here is a quick cheat sheet to avoid the pain.

Term What It Means My Advice
Wagering (35x) You must bet the bonus amount 35 times before withdrawing. Look for 35x or lower. 50x is a trap.
Max Cashout (£100) You can only keep £100 from your winnings. Check this. Some offers cap you at £50, which is low.
Game Contribution (10%) Only 10% of your bet on a specific game counts towards wagering. Avoid high-volatility slots that contribute low percentages.
Time Limit (72 hours) You have to complete wagering in 3 days. Hard pass for me. I prefer 7-30 days.
Payment Restrictions You can’t use Skrill or Neteller to claim the bonus. Use a debit card (Visa/Mastercard) to be safe.

One offer I saw had a 60x wagering requirement on a £10 bonus. That means you have to bet £600 before you can withdraw anything. That is a terrible deal. I ignored that one.

Can I withdraw the free spins winnings immediately?

No. Almost never. You have to meet the wagering requirements first. For example, if you win £50 from a free spin bonus with 35x wagering, you must place bets totalling £1,750 before you can cash out. It is a grind.

Do I need to deposit to get a no deposit bonus?

Usually, yes. Even if it says “no deposit”, you often have to make a small deposit first to unlock the bonus. Some are truly free, but those are rare. Check the “How to Claim” section. I have seen offers that require a £10 deposit to unlock a £5 no deposit bonus.

How do I know if a casino is UKGC licensed?

Scroll to the very bottom of the homepage. Look for a logo that says “UK Gambling Commission” or “UKGC”. The license number will be there. If it is not there, do not play. It is not worth the risk.

What happens to my VIP points if I take a no deposit bonus?

Great question. On some sites, your points are frozen until you clear the wagering. On others, you still earn points. I prefer the latter. You can usually see your point balance in your account dashboard. If it is frozen, wait until you clear the bonus before you play any other games.

Can I use a no deposit bonus on live dealer games?

Very rarely. Most of these bonuses are for slots only. Live dealer games often have a 0% contribution to wagering. So if you try to play Blackjack with a free spins bonus, it won’t help you clear the playthrough.
